LEARN TO EARN
Learn to Earn is a transformative project dedicated to empowering youth through vocational skill training, aligning with SDG 8 (Decent Work and Economic Growth) and SDG 4 (Quality Education). By offering comprehensive training in fields such as dressmaking, hairdressing, tailoring, glazing, tiling, and graphic designing, we contribute directly to SDG 8’s target of promoting sustained, inclusive, and sustainable economic growth, full and productive employment, and decent work for all. Moreover, this initiative supports SDG 4 by providing quality education and creating lifelong learning opportunities for young individuals. Through partnerships with small credit unions, we provide seed capital as soft loans, ensuring that our beneficiaries have the means to start their own businesses, thus fostering entrepreneurship and economic empowerment among youth

1 MILLION YOUTH IN TECH
The 1 Million Youth in Tech initiative seeks to empower 1 million young individuals across West Africa with comprehensive IT skills, including both coding and non-coding proficiencies. Commencing in Ghana, our primary objective is to equip these youths with the tools necessary to thrive in the ever-evolving IT sector, fostering innovation and economic growth. By harnessing technology, we’re committed to addressing poverty and fostering sustainable development within the region, aligning with SDG 1: No Poverty and SDG 9: Industry, Innovation, and Infrastructure.
